HOW TO PROCEED WITH TROUBLESHOOTING [03/2012 - 07/2012]
HINT
- Use the following procedure to troubleshoot the power window control system.
- *: Use the Techstream.
- VEHICLE BROUGHT TO WORKSHOP NEXT: Go to next step
- CUSTOMER PROBLEM ANALYSIS In troubleshooting, confirm that the problem symptoms have been accurately identified. Preconceptions should be discarded in order to make an accurate judgment. To clearly understand what the problem symptoms are, it is extremely important to ask the customer about the problem and the conditions at the time the malfunction occurred. Gather as much information as possible for reference. Past problems that seem unrelated may also help in some cases. The following 5 items are important points in the problem analysis: What Vehicle model, system name When Date, time, occurrence frequency Where Road conditions Under what conditions? Driving conditions, weather conditions How did it happen? Problem symptoms NEXT: Go to next step
- PRE-CHECK Measure the battery voltage. Standard Voltage 11 to 14 V If the voltage is below 11 V, recharge or replace the battery before proceeding to the next step. Check the fuses and relays. Check the connector connections and terminals to make sure that there are no abnormalities such as loose connections, deformation, etc. NEXT: Go to next step
- INSPECT COMMUNICATION FUNCTION OF CAN COMMUNICATION SYSTEM* Use the Techstream to check if the CAN communication system is functioning normally. Result Result Proceed to ECU connected, communication line is normally A ECU connected, communication line is malfunctioning B B --> GO TO CAN COMMUNICATION SYSTEM. Refer to «HOW TO PROCEED WITH TROUBLESHOOTING [03/2012 - 07/2012]»(ref-602741-S42866298922014030500000) A: Go to next step
- INSPECT COMMUNICATION FUNCTION OF LIN COMMUNICATION SYSTEM* Use the Techstream to check if the LIN communication system is functioning normally. Refer to «DTC CHECK / CLEAR [03/2012 - ]»(ref-602774-S17650513242014030500000) . Result Result Proceed to No DTCs output A DTCs output B B --> GO TO LIN COMMUNICATION SYSTEM. Refer to «DIAGNOSTIC TROUBLE CODE CHART [03/2012 - ]»(ref-602774-S26691742372014030500000) A: Go to next step
- CHECK FOR DTC* Check for DTCs and note any codes that are output. Refer to «DTC CHECK / CLEAR [03/2012 - ]»(ref-602570-S28479883682014030500000) . Clear the DTCs. Recheck for DTCs. Result Result Proceed to No DTCs output A DTCs output B B --> GO TO DIAGNOSTIC TROUBLE CODE CHART. Refer to «DIAGNOSTIC TROUBLE CODE CHART [03/2012 - ]»(ref-602570-S13692277922014030500000) A: Go to next step
- PROBLEM SYMPTOMS TABLE Refer to Problem Symptoms Table. Refer to «PROBLEM SYMPTOMS TABLE [03/2012 - ]»(ref-602570-S38864314332014030500000) . Result Result Proceed to Fault is not listed in problem symptoms table A Fault is listed in problem symptoms table B B --> Go to step 9 A: Go to next step
- OVERALL ANALYSIS AND TROUBLESHOOTING* Operation Check. Refer to «OPERATION CHECK [03/2012 - ]»(ref-602570-S27952816082014030500000) Data List / Active Test. Refer to «DATA LIST / ACTIVE TEST [03/2012 - ]»(ref-602570-S34440256682014030500000) Terminals of ECU. Refer to «TERMINALS OF ECU [03/2012 - ]»(ref-602570-S28141892592014030500000) NEXT: Go to next step
- ADJUST, REPAIR OR REPLACE Check if any of the door window regulators or power window regulator motor assemblies have been removed and reinstalled. Result Result Proceed to Any of the door window regulators or power window regulator motor assemblies have been removed and reinstalled. A None of the door window regulators or power window regulator motor assemblies has been removed and reinstalled. B B --> Go to step 11 A: Go to next step
- INITIALIZE POWER WINDOW REGULATOR MOTOR If any of the door window regulators or power window regulator motor assemblies have been removed and reinstalled, perform "Initialize Power Window Control System" (initialization of the pulse sensor) for the applicable door glass. Refer to «INITIALIZATION [03/2012 - ]»(ref-602570-S16724986282014030500000) . HINT: If "Initialize Power Window Control System" (initialization of the pulse sensor) has not been performed, the auto operation function, jam protection function, key-linked operation function, wireless transmitter-linked operation function and key-off operation function will not operate or will operate incorrectly. NEXT: Go to next step
- CONFIRMATION TEST NEXT --> END

- CHECK JAM PROTECTION FUNCTION Check the basic function. WARNING: Do not put your fingers between the door frame and door glass to check the jam protection function. Also, prevent any part of your body from being caught during inspection. HINT: The jam protection function is operative during both the auto up and manual up operations while the engine is running or the engine switch is on (IG), and also 45 sec. have elapsed after the engine switch is turned off. Fully open the window. Set a thick book wrapped with a piece of cloth near the window fully closed position. Operate the auto up or manual up function to check that the power window goes down after the book is caught between the window and door frame, and stops when the opening reaches approximately 200 mm (7.87 in.). HINT: The power window moves down approximately 125 mm (4.93 in.). However, when the opening does not reach 200 mm (7.87 in.), the power window continues to go down until the opening reaches 200 mm (7.87 in.) or until approximately 5 seconds elapse. While the power window is moving down, check that the door glass cannot be raised when the power window switch is used.

- POWER WINDOW OPERATION IN FAIL-SAFE MODE HINT: If the pulse sensor built into the power window regulator motor malfunctions, the power window control system enters fail-safe mode. The power window control system prohibits the following power window operations when the pulse sensor for the jam protection function has problems and the window position or the learned value is abnormal. MULTIPLEX NETWORK MASTER SWITCH ASSEMBLY Power Window Operation Condition Engine switch on (IG) Engine switch off (Key-off operation permitted) Engine switch off (Key-off operation prohibited) Manual up (Driver side door window) X X - Manual down (Driver side door window) o X - Auto up (Driver side door window) (hold switch at auto up position) o* X - Auto up (Driver side door window) X X - Auto down (Driver side door window) X X - Manual up (Remote switch operation) X X - Manual down (Remote switch operation) X X - Auto up (Remote switch operation) (hold switch at auto up position) X X - Auto up (Remote switch operation) X X - Auto down (Remote switch operation) X X - Key-linked open and close - X X Wireless transmitter-linked open - X X HINT: o: Operates X: Operation prohibited *: Operates in manual mode without jam protection POWER WINDOW REGULATOR SWITCH ASSEMBLY (FOR FRONT PASSENGER, REAR LH AND REAR RH SIDES) Power Window Operation Condition Engine switch on (IG) Engine switch off (Key-off operation permitted) Engine switch off (Key-off operation prohibited) Manual up X X - Manual down o X - Auto up (hold switch at auto up position) o* X - Auto up X X - Auto down X X - Key-linked open and close - X X Wireless transmitter-linked open - X X HINT: o: Operates X: Operation prohibited *: Operates in manual mode without jam protection Power window switch LED control HINT: During normal operation (fail-safe is not operating), or during fail-safe mode when there is a pulse sensor malfunction or the window position or learned value is abnormal, the LED illuminates as shown in the illustration. For driver side: For front passenger side, rear LH and rear RH sides: Fail-safe deactivation condition When the pulse sensor is normal, to deactivate fail-safe mode, pull up the power window switch to the auto up position and hold it for at least 1 second to fully close the window from the fully open position. As a result, the auto up/down function will return. - ACTIVE TEST HINT: Using the Techstream to perform Active Tests allows relays, VSVs, actuators and other items to be operated without removing any parts. This non-intrusive functional inspection can be very useful because intermittent operation may be discovered before parts or wiring is disturbed. Performing Active Tests early in troubleshooting is one way to save diagnostic time. Data List information can be displayed while performing Active Tests. Connect the Techstream to the DLC3. Turn the engine switch on (IG). Turn the Techstream on. Enter the following menus: Body Electrical / (desired system) / Active Test. Perform the Active Test according to the display on the Techstream. WARNING: Be careful to avoid injuries as this test causes vehicle parts to move. During the Active Test, the jam protection function will not operate.
